Diet Nut Cake

Diet nut cake — light, easy and delicious. Using a small amount of brown sugar and whole wheat flour lowers the calories and makes the cake healthier.

Total time55 min
Prep15 min
Cook40 min
Yield8 servings
DifficultyEasy

Ingredients

  • 2 eggs
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1 tsp lemon zest
  • 1/2 cup lemon or orange juice
  • 1/3 cup oil
  • 1 1/2 cups whole wheat flour
  • 1 tbsp baking powder
  • a pinch of vanilla
  • Nuts: raisins, walnuts, almonds, cashews

Method

  1. Beat the eggs with the sugar, lemon zest and vanilla until the sugar dissolves completely and the mixture is thick and pale.
  2. Add the juice and oil and beat well.
  3. Sift the flour and baking powder, add gradually, and fold with a spoon from top to bottom until the batter is uniform.
  4. Toss the nuts in a little flour so they don’t sink to the bottom when added.
  5. Grease the cake pan with oil or butter and dust with flour. Pour the batter into the pan and spread the floured nuts on top.
  6. Bake in a preheated oven at 160°C (320°F) for about 30 minutes, or adjust according to your oven.
    Timers: 30 min
  7. Let the cake cool before removing it from the pan and serving.
